I received a message from Thervo about a notary request in Jacksonville, FL. I don’t remember signing up for this service, but my information could have been sourced elsewhere. To access lead information, they required credit card details—a significant red flag. After researching and reading reviews on Trustpilot, I decided to delete my account as I found the service non-credible.
